- Choose a project (whch is not yet assigned or done by anyone)
- Choose the framework/languages to work on.
- Create an issue specifying the project and the framework you want to work on.
- As soon as one of the maintainers approve the issuse, Start Hacking!!!
- Fork this repo (fork option present on the top right corner)
- Clone the forked project (imp)
- If a folder related to the framework you are using is present, start working inside it. If it's not present first create the folder for the specific framework.
- After navigating to the right folder, create a new folder for your project
- If you have correctly setup the project, it will look similar to the snippet below, now you can start building

- Ensure you have added a readme, specifying the details about the project and how to build and run the project
- For flutter projects, you can add a codepen link for faster access
- While sending PR, follow the PR template provided and fill in all the details
- Commit more often for every new feature you added
- Keep a check on the branch you are working on
